Toggle navigation

Home Depot
Home Depot
in Mountain Square - Upland, California (hours, location)

Store rating:
Store rating:

4/5 (80 %), 1 vote

Write a review »

Home Depot in Mountain Square shopping details
Home Depot in Mountain Square shopping details

Home Depot in Mountain Square, address and location: Upland, California - 320 S Mountain Ave, Upland, California - CA 91786. Hours including holiday hours and Black Friday information. Don't forget to write a review about your visit at Home Depot in Mountain Square and rate this store ».

Useful links: All stores in Mountain Square | The Home Depot store locator | Hours Mountain Square | Mountain Square Location

Home Depot in Mountain Square opening hours (mall hours)

Mountain Square
Black Friday & Holiday hours »


Mountain Square location and map
Mountain Square location and map

Home Depot in Mountain Square - store location plan
Home Depot in Mountain Square - store location plan

Haven't found what you are looking for? Try helpful links:
Haven't found what you are looking for? Try helpful links:

Help other customers/shoppers and write review about shopping in Home Depot, Mountain Square. And rate this location!
Help other customers/shoppers and write review about shopping in Home Depot, Mountain Square. And rate this location!

We do not collect any personal information and we do not provide any of the information to third-party services.

There are no reviews yet.

Go back to top

© Travel Outlets ltd.  2016 - 2025

Switch to full version